Chris Mason article on STLToday

So i was just over there and morons are over that comment on the story are trashing the Blues in the way they draft and sign players.

“Blues should have taken Kane over Johnson…what were they thinking?” That kind of stupid crap that shows these people don’t know a damn thing as Kane was taken a year later than Johnson.

Onto my point….I don’t have a problem with the Blues signing Mason. In fact, I think it makes sense as long as it’s a 2 year deal. Despite everyone saying goaltending matters, Niemi and Leighton are playing for the cup folks. You know who is also playing for the cup? Chris Pronger, Duncan Keith, and Brent Seabrook. My feeling on the matter is the defense in front of the goalie, is what makes the difference. I’m not dissing goalies in anyway, but at the NHL level, an average NHL goaltender (i.e. Chris Mason), will stop most shots that he can see, ones that aren’t being deflected, and not ones where a rebound goes out to an uncovered player from the back door. And who, ladies and gentlemen, control these events which most NHL goals are scored? Defensemen.

For me, Blues have done a great job of stocking up on defensemen prospects that have great upside. Once we get Petrangelo, Cole, Rundblad, etc up here and have these guys replace the Eric Brewers and Jackmans, the sooner we will be to being a Cup contender. Replacing Mason, with another guy that isn’t really any better, is just pointless. Luongo’s don’t grow on trees. The difference between one of the top 3 goalies and the rest of the pack is huge…unless you have one of those guys, have a guy like Chris Mason, and have a strong defense than can transition the puck. The teams that have won the Cup have one or the other. Through drafting, you can get these type of defensemen; the Blackhawks have (see Keith, Duncan and Seabrook, Brent) and have gotten to the finals with a no-name goalie that they just about cut prior to the season.
